Output f9518ff7303b3bf875fd63d3d470daf4a931eba180978c0ca95965ba5779119f:11

value
102677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62da5a07cb688fb21ff97a326a7bd5a7472c199b OP_EQUAL
address
3Ahhigd174m8UjSyCYw66R46AZyf3BeUtd
transaction
f9518ff7303b3bf875fd63d3d470daf4a931eba180978c0ca95965ba5779119f
confirmations
174987
spent
true